Output 98945e77750f0320e924198a1df6d6371389a2c7a45bd8fe109813cb0ecd2cd2:0

value
2376240659
script pubkey
OP_0 OP_PUSHBYTES_20 50871de7d518aa3e5e2f4441e761a9ffbc8a4851
address
tb1q2zr3me74rz4ruh30g3q7wcdfl77g5jz35zncze
transaction
98945e77750f0320e924198a1df6d6371389a2c7a45bd8fe109813cb0ecd2cd2